I wanted to mount my ipad (for mapping gia/onX) trail use above the radio/hvac vents. I don’t have a cage with the cross bar above the dash (yet) and I couldn’t find a suitable mounting point. I pulled the narrow dash section off (near the windshield) and found a couple studs with nuts that I assume are hold in the dash structure in place. These studs had enough threads exposed that I figured I could screw a “standoff” onto that would allow me to make a “mini cross bar”.
I machined a couple ½” OD aluminum pcs to a suitable length and drilled tapped them to fit the studs. I had to notch the dash plastic pcs to clear these studs (see pic).
I printed a couple end pcs that would fit over a ¾” bar and then screw into the standoffs. I notched the bar to allow the screws that screw into the standoff prevent the bar from rotating. I used an old 67 designs mounting bits to mount the ipad holder (I printed the holder as well) its plenty sturdy and doesn’t
bounce around.
